Hofmeister secures distribution deal amid Keystone woes
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-12 12:38
Core Insights - Hofmeister Brewing Co. has appointed a new UK distributor, Kingfisher Drinks, following Keystone Brewing Group's notice to appoint administrators, which was filed in November [1][2] - The CEO of Hofmeister emphasized the company's independence and operational efficiency with the new distributor, aiming to ensure timely delivery of products [3] Company Developments - Hofmeister was previously distributed by Keystone, which had been handling its sales in the UK since their partnership began in March [2] - The company has transitioned from a start-up phase to a scale-up phase, reporting a 30% year-on-year increase in volumes in Q4 2025, with sales exceeding £3 million ($4 million) [4] Financial Outlook - For 2026, Hofmeister is forecasting continued double-digit growth, targeting over 30% year-on-year growth, with the new distribution deal seen as critical for profitability [5] - The company is profitable at a gross margin level for every keg sold and has made strategic investments in brand building and infrastructure in 2025 to support its growth plans for 2026 [6] Market Position - Hofmeister aims to capture the UK on-trade market, identifying a gap in the 'world lager' category for a genuine imported German helles, while also noting a small but growing export presence [6][7]

Heineken CEO, facing slow sales and unsatisfied investors, steps down
Reuters· 2026-01-12 07:17
Core Insights - Heineken's CEO Dolf van den Brink unexpectedly resigned after six years of leadership, shortly after unveiling a new strategy for the company [1] Company Summary - The resignation comes at a challenging time for the brewing industry, which is facing difficulties in adapting to changing consumer preferences and market conditions [1]

Asia’s IPO boom shows no sign of slowing in 2026
BusinessLine· 2026-01-05 03:20
Core Insights - Asia's equity capital markets are projected to have a strong performance in 2026, continuing the momentum from 2025, which saw significant growth in share sales across the region [1][2] Group 1: Market Performance - In 2025, share listings, placements, and block trades in Asia Pacific raised $262.7 billion, marking the highest total in four years [2] - For the first time, four of the world's five busiest deal venues were located in Asia, driven by a rebound in Hong Kong and record IPOs in India [2] Group 2: Upcoming IPOs - Major IPOs expected in 2026 include Baidu Inc., Zepto Ltd., ChangXin Memory Technologies Inc., and Coca-Cola's India bottling unit [3] - Hong Kong listings of Chinese firms already traded in mainland China are anticipated to continue contributing to the IPO pipeline [3] Group 3: Regional Highlights - Hong Kong listings may raise up to $45 billion in 2026, potentially the largest amount in six years, while Indian IPOs are expected to achieve a third consecutive annual record [4] - Jio Platforms Ltd. is preparing for what could be India's largest-ever IPO, while A.S. Watson Group is considering a listing that could raise over $2 billion [8] Group 4: Notable Companies and Their Plans - Syngenta Group is in preliminary talks for a potential listing in 2026 after previously withdrawing a $9 billion plan [8] - Baidu's AI chip unit has confidentially filed for a Hong Kong IPO, valued at a minimum of $3 billion [8] - Other companies like Luxshare Precision Industry Co. and Muyuan Foods Co. are also pursuing significant IPOs in Hong Kong [8] Group 5: Indian Market Developments - PhonePe Ltd. has filed for an IPO that could raise up to $1.5 billion, valuing the fintech firm at approximately $15 billion [13] - Flipkart is exploring an IPO after moving its holding company to India, while Zepto aims to raise about $500 million through its IPO [13] Group 6: International Listings - SK Hynix Inc. is considering a potential New York listing to align its valuation with global peers [13] - Shein Group Ltd. has confidentially filed for a Hong Kong IPO, pending approval from Beijing [13]
